#c9e5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c9e5ff is composed of 78.8% red, 89.8%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.2% cyan, 10.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 208.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 89.4%. #c9e5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#93cbff.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#c9e5ff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c9e5ff has RGB values of R:201, G:229,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 13231615.

Shades and Tints of #c9e5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000305 is the darkest color, while #f0f8ff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c9e5ff is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#e0e0e0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#dbe1e6 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#dfe1fc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e8deff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cae7f8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d7e2fd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dce0ff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c9e6fa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
